# ropewalk

> English word · Noun

## Definitions
1. A place where rope is made, a rope factory.
2. A long straight narrow lane, or a covered pathway, where long strands of material were laid before being twisted into rope.
3. Any narrow walkway that has rope handrails.

## Etymology
From rope + walk.
